Analysis

Lesotho recorded 0.7561 for export unit values, us dollar in 2014.

The figure is up 16.0% on the previous year and up 229.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, export unit values, us dollar in Lesotho peaked at 1.18 in 2003 and was at its lowest, 0.2296, in 2004.

Lesotho ranks 65th of 166 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 14 years of available data.

This dataset provides export quality indicators for over 800 products across 166 countries from 1963 to 2014, resulting in over 1.7 million observations. Higher index values indicate higher quality, and the index is normalized with a value of 1 representing the 90th percentile of export quality among all exporters (the world frontier). Data can be aggregated at various levels, including by product according to the Standard International Trade Classification (SITC) up to the 4-digit level, by Broad Economic Categories (BEC) up to the 3-digit level, and by aggregate sectors such as Agriculture, Commodities, and Manufactures.
